Title:
Biologically Based Non-Language Speech Sound Detection

Abstract:
This proposal addresses the application of new acoustic processing technologies to automatically identify and eliminate non-language speech sounds as a pre-processing stage to improve audio processing. Non-language speech sounds make up a large part of natural human language use, but contemporary speech recognition data preparation relies on hand-labeling of non-language speech sounds. The proposed work will extend the capabilities of a computational model of auditory processing based on multiscale spectro-temporal modulation features to the automated detection of non-language speech sounds. Advanced Acoustic Concepts and the University of Maryland have extensive experience applying the computational model to a variety of sound recognition and sound stream segregation problems. One particularly relevant application involved distinguishing speech from non-speech sounds consisting of animal vocalizations, music, and environmental sounds. Using a sound database to be provided by the sponsor, algorithms will be trained and tested in a similar fashion to distinguish non-language speech sounds from language. Algorithms for exact segmentation of the sound stream will be designed and demonstrated.
